Frequently Asked Questions:
Is Mississippi Chicken spicy?
The spice level of Mississippi Chicken primarily comes from the barbecue sauce you choose. Most standard barbecue sauces have a mild kick, but if you prefer a milder flavor, opt for a sweet or honey-based barbecue sauce. For those who enjoy a bit more heat, a spicy or smoky barbecue sauce will do the trick. You can also add a pinch of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es to the sauce mixture for extra heat.
Can I make Mississippi Chicken ahead of time?
Yes, you absolutely can! Mississippi Chicken is a fantastic make-ahead meal. You can prepare the entire dish and refrigerate it for up to 2-3 days before reheating. Alternatively, you can cook the chicken and prepare the sauce mixture separately and combine them to reheat just before serving. This makes it incredibly convenient for busy schedules.

Mississippi Chicken
A simple and flavorful slow cooker recipe for tender Mississippi Chicken.
Ingredients
-
2 pounds chicken breasts (boneless and skinless)
-
1 1-ounce packet au jus mix
-
1 1-ounce packet ranch seasoning
-
2 tablespoons butter (sliced into pats)
-
6 pepperoncini peppers
Instructions
-
Step 1
Place chicken breasts in the bottom of a slow cooker. -
Step 2
In a small bowl, whisk together the au jus mix and ranch seasoning. -
Step 3
Sprinkle the seasoning mixture evenly over the chicken. -
Step 4
Arrange the butter pats on top of the chicken. -
Step 5
Add the pepperoncini peppers around the chicken. -
Step 6
Cover and cook on low for 4-6 hours, or until chicken is tender and cooked through. -
Step 7
Shred the chicken with two forks, then stir to combine with the sauce.
